Meeting Hana-Maru, The Good-Natured Seal
- White seal standing upright with a smooth, continuous outline from head to tail.
- Large rounded head that is wider than the body.
- Tiny dot eyes placed far apart and slightly above the center of the head.
- Simple mouth that looks like a rounded “w” shape.
- Three short whisker lines on each cheek, angled slightly.
- Body shaped like a long vertical capsule that ends in a small split tail fin.
- Front flippers drawn as curved lines on the torso, forming a simple gesture of holding the stem.
- Single red flower with a round center and simple petals, positioned in front of the chest.
